问题标签 [lost-focus]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
939 浏览

android - 带有可编辑内容的 Android webview 失去了焦点

我一直在尝试使用 Webview实现RichTextEditor 。Webview 加载了内容可编辑的 html。要专注于第一次,我需要在 webview 上单击三次以上。当我们再次单击输入文本的末尾或行尾以获得焦点时,它也会失去焦点,我需要多次单击。

我已经完成了以下操作以使其具有焦点。

并在自定义 Webview的 onTouch 中请求焦点,当它失去焦点时。

注意: 我正在运行 javascript 以将样式应用于在 webview 中输入的文本。

请告诉我我错过了什么。

-谢谢

0 投票
2 回答
8353 浏览

jquery - 只关注一次 - Jquery

嗨朋友们,我有一个 textarea,我想使用这个元素animate()并发挥作用。css()

css()功能正常工作,但问题是focus()功能。页面加载后一切正常,

当我聚焦到 textarea 时,它的高度增加了 50px,但是当我模糊然后再次聚焦到 textarea 时,高度又增加了 50px。

我不想使用blur()函数。

我的问题是关于使用focus()功能。我想focus() 每次页面加载使用一次。

0 投票
1 回答
343 浏览

java - GWT:当我编辑文本框并保存时焦点消失

我有一个点击该链接的链接,可以在文本框中编辑该链接的名称。

在此处输入图像描述

编辑后保存和关闭选项在那里。保存后,焦点从链接中消失,我需要焦点必须留在链接上。

在此处输入图像描述

我在用

对于链接,但它会只关注一秒钟,而不是永久地关注该链接。寻找解决方案。

谢谢..!!

0 投票
1 回答
3978 浏览

vb.net - 如何使用组合框更改事件触发代码

我创建了一个包含历史股票价格的数据库。在我的表单上,我有两个组合框,ComboBox_Ticker并且ComboBox_Date. 当这些组合框被填充时,我想检查数据库并查看数据库中是否存在相应的数据。如果是这样,我想将名为“In Database”的标签的文本更改Label_If_Present为“In Database”。

我的问题发生在更改事件上。一旦我更改了文本框中的数据,我希望所有这一切都发生。我已经尝试了.TextChanged.LostFocus事件。'.TextChanged' 会提前触发代码并在我的 SQL 命令语句中抛出错误。`.LostFocus' 事件根本不会触发我的代码。

这是我当前的代码:

我已经在我的项目中的其他形式上成功地实现了这个概念。这个有点不同,我不知道为什么我不能让这个工作。

0 投票
2 回答
3228 浏览

delphi - 如何判断非模态已经失去/重新获得焦点

我有一个主窗体和一个辅助窗体,它们都带有来自公共数据库的一些 DBAware 控件。目前我正在使用 ShowModal 但我希望能够使用 Modal 返回主窗体并导航数据库。

在二级中,我可以用 TEdits 替换 TDBEdits,并在显示二级表单时用数据填充它们。没有办法在辅助窗体中导航数据库,但是,如果用户可以返回到他们可以导航的主窗体,我将需要在他们返回辅助窗体时重置数据库光标。

我怎么知道辅助表单刚刚失去焦点?我可以抓取数据库光标位置。

我如何判断辅助表单何时再次获得焦点?因此,如果在返回之前移动了数据库游标,我可以重置它。

谢谢 ps 请不要对原因和/或替代建议提出任何问题。这是一个现有的应用程序,我真的不想修复数英里的代码。尽管它很糟糕,但它已经工作了多年,客户希望改变可能。:)

0 投票
2 回答
1212 浏览

google-chrome - Chrome 在 Google 页面上打字时失去焦点

我在谷歌浏览器的 gmail/google 翻译器上输入邮件或翻译某些东西时遇到了问题。总是在发生 ajax 时 - 自动翻译/自动草稿将框保存到我目前正在输入的内容中只是失去焦点,我需要再次单击它。我已经尝试安装另一个版本的 Chrome - 当前测试版:29.0.1547.49 beta-m。但是没有任何改变,它与稳定版本 28 上的相同......在另一个浏览器中它可以正常工作。我过去没有安装任何扩展程序,也不记得在 Chrome 中设置任何东西。我正在运行已通过实际更新完全升级的 Windows 7。

如果有人遇到同样的问题或知道如何解决,我将不胜感激。

谢谢!

0 投票
3 回答
6283 浏览

android - 按下“返回”键时如何使edittext失去焦点?

当我按下 'Return' 键时EditText,它会通过变大来制作新行。EditText按下“返回”键时如何失去焦点?换句话说,当按下'Return'时如何让键盘消失?

0 投票
1 回答
2284 浏览

java - Validation of mobile number field

I want to know what's wrong with this code? I am taking my input in the textbox(A 10-digit mobile number). My problem is that, this code all the time prints else statement even if my input is correct.

0 投票
1 回答
1472 浏览

c# - DevExpress XtraGrid 更新失去焦点

当行的焦点丢失时,我想禁用网格的更新事件。因此,在我添加/编辑记录并单击以前的记录后,网格不应更新。有任何想法吗?

0 投票
1 回答
1302 浏览

jquery - JQuery检测到页面上另一个元素的焦点丢失但浏览器没有丢失焦点

使用 jquery,我正在使用 blur 事件检测文本框失去焦点。

然后我隐藏文本框并将其替换为包含输入文本的标签。

我的问题是,即使浏览器失去焦点,也会触发此事件(在 linux/firefox 下,即使按下“Alt Gr”键在文本框中插入特殊字符(如 arobase @)也会发生这种情况)

是否可以检测到焦点仅丢失到页面上的另一个元素?

编辑:添加示例 jsfiddle http://jsfiddle.net/XMp5n/

相关代码: